Special education process in class
Step 1: Identify the IEP students
Observe the behaviors
document child's difficulties and challenges
Monitor student's progress
Determine developmental delays in the age group
Refer RTI, or certified resources to determine if students meets the standards.
Test the regular class management skills and accommodations to see if it is able to be handled
Step 2: Communicate with admin and parents(referral)
Share the documented observations
Prove and explain how standards from certified resources like RTI indicates this students' behavior.
Provide evidences of visible indications of a disability
Compare students ' behavior from home and classroom
Step 3: Implementing IEP
Teachers who can provide individualized support should be assiged for each student
Student will receive a special accommodations and the array of multidisciplinary services
Give alternative assessment procedures
Set differentiated classroom expectations at their standards
Step 4: Evaluation
Hold a periodical IEP Review meeting,
Assess whether the student is meeting their goals and making educational progress
Teachers should record daily data and weekly reports about the students
Share this information with the admin and the parents.
Make further plan to help the student to learn better
